    I have never been able to delete messages in Phone Link. I don't see any option to do that. I've always deleted them on the phone. If they are deleted on the phone but still exist in Phone Link then (ON THE PHONE) you have to go to the Archived or Spam & Blocked section and delete the message. You reach this area (at least on my Samsung S24+) by touching the "face" icon next to the Search magnifying glass, then select Archived or Spam & Blocked and delete any you find there. Then they will be gone in Phone Link.

    The 3 dots (ellipses), shown in the Phone Link message listing will give you Pin, Mute & Hide, nothing else.
